Job retention vocational rehabilitation for employed people with inflammatory arthritis (WORK-IA) : a feasibility randomized controlled trial (2017)
Journal Article
controlled trial. BMC Musculoskeletal Disorders, 18, 315. https://doi.org/10.1186/s12891-017-1671-5

Background: Inflammatory arthritis leads to work disability, absenteeism and presenteeism (i.e. at-work productivity loss) at high cost to individuals, employers and society. The effects of arthritis gloves on people with rheumatoid arthritis or inflammatory arthritis with hand pain : a study protocol for a multi-centre randomised controlled trial (the A-GLOVES trial) (2017)
Journal Article
Prior, Y., Sutton, C., Cotterill, S., Adams, J., Camacho, E., Arafin, N., …Hammond, A. (2017). The effects of arthritis gloves on people with rheumatoid arthritis or inflammatory arthritis with hand pain : a study protocol for a multi-centre randomised controlled trial (the A-GLOVES trial). BMC Musculoskeletal Disorders, 18, 224-239. https://doi.org/10.1186/s12891-017-1583-4

Background: Arthritis gloves are regularly provided as part of the management of people with rheumatoid arthritis (RA) and undifferentiated (early) inflammatory arthritis (IA).
